Mercedes-Benz Malaysia sees 5.5% increase in sales for commercial vehicles

2015 was not only a very fruitful year for Mercedes-Benz Malaysia in the passenger cars segment, but in the commercial vehicles segment as well. 

The company announced today that it recorded total sales of 2,623 commercial vehicles last year, which translates to a 5.5 per cent increase from 2014. 

Out of the total, 2,430 units were Mitsubishi Fuso trucks, while the remaining 193 were  Mercedes-Benz  commercial vehicles.

Besides the increase in sales, the company also celebrated several highlights in 2015 which included the production of its 25,000th unit in Malaysia, and the extension of its Fuso product portfolio with the launch of the new FM and FN series.

Reviewing its 2015 performance, Mercedes-Benz Malaysia Commercial Vehicles’ vice president Albert Yee said, “Amidst challenging market conditions, Mercedes-Benz Malaysia Commercial Vehicles has increased sales, market share, launched a new truck series, and simultaneously achieved significant milestones at our Pekan production plant.”

“We concluded 2015 on a high note, securing several fleet deals with long-standing customers. Their belief in Mercedes-Benz Commercial Vehicles and FUSO Trucks are a testament to the hallmark quality and service that we deliver. Customers are at the heart of our business and as a producer of leading commercial vehicle brand; we aim to meet their need for quality vehicles.”

Mercedes-Benz Malaysia, which currently has 15 outlets for its commercial vehicles, and 57 authorised outlets for Fuso, also announced that it is currently working towards updating its 24-hour breakdown system that is supported by its service centres.
